Perched atop a basalt cone in the Upper Palatinate region of Bavaria, Germany, Burgruine Waldeck is the evocative ruin of a medieval summit castle. Overlooking the village of Waldeck near Kemnath, this historical site stands at an elevation of approximately 618 meters, offering a tangible connection to centuries past. It is renowned as one of the oldest castles in the Upper Palatinate, with its origins dating back to the 12th century.

    The Waldecker Schlossberg bears the remains of a castle that is one of the oldest in the Upper Palatinate. It was first mentioned in documents in 1124. In 1794, a devastating fire destroyed the castle and the town of Waldeck.

    The village of Waldeck was rebuilt around the pilgrimage church of St. Johannes Nepomuk, which was built north of Schlossberg in 1731. The climb to the lovingly restored castle ruin is worth it simply because of the phenomenal view.

    What historical events shaped Burgruine Waldeck?

    Burgruine Waldeck is one of the oldest castles in the Upper Palatinate, first mentioned in documents as early as 1124. It suffered a devastating fire in 1794, which destroyed both the castle and the nearby town. Extensive excavation and restoration efforts by the Waldeck Local History and Culture Association have helped preserve its remains and tell its story.

    What cultural events are held at Burgruine Waldeck?

    The site is not just a historical landmark but also a cultural venue. Regular services are held at the St. Ägidius open-air chapel, and theater performances by the Upper Palatinate State Theater are a permanent part of the cultural program, taking place on an open-air stage with 300 seats.
